Louisville Eastern went to 2-0 with a huge win over Louisville Manual HS 101-54.
BU recruit Remy Abell had 19 points, including a game-high 3 three pointers.

I was at the Limestone/ND game last night. First off, Limestone, save for Stewart, is really, really bad. He has absolutely no help. He was not Triple teamed but even when he gave up the ball his defender really didn't even pay attention to the rest of the players or the ball, basically just faced Stewart and spied him the whole time....When Stewart did penetrate, the rest of the Irish players were very quick to rotate and help, basically leaving their man totally to help.


I wasnt overly impressed with Biefeldt, he was good, but I think he's gonna have a few issues at D1. He was pretty slow with the ball around the basket, wasn't as big(bulky) as I thought he was gonna be, and didn't really see any true offense from him. Got a lot of points because Limestone's press was awful and didn't have anybody over 6'4. Mostly layups and free throws. Maybe hes got a lot more in the repertoire, but just didn't see it last night cuz he didn't need it...IDK.
